diff options
| author | Kenny Root <kroot@google.com> | 2010-11-02 11:27:21 -0700 |
|---|---|---|
| committer | Kenny Root <kroot@google.com> | 2010-11-02 11:27:31 -0700 |
| commit | 5c4cf8cd7ccd76f25a8433096774b44a6dd8ead8 (patch) | |
| tree | 51ef6e7399b75a089cf68f6ec0eaeaa0c2760b28 | |
| parent | 460119b7ea7a4ca8490db9af5c2983419dd816b0 (diff) | |
| download | frameworks_base-5c4cf8cd7ccd76f25a8433096774b44a6dd8ead8.zip frameworks_base-5c4cf8cd7ccd76f25a8433096774b44a6dd8ead8.tar.gz frameworks_base-5c4cf8cd7ccd76f25a8433096774b44a6dd8ead8.tar.bz2 | |
Fix default return code for getResource
Reorganization of getResource to allow for other densities accidentally
overrode the default return code for getResource from BAD_VALUE to
BAD_INDEX. This corrects the default return to BAD_VALUE which restores
other things to working.
Bug: 3155824
Change-Id: I13dafff85bc6978c5f5435fc09ab0474c7885c4d
| -rw-r--r-- | libs/utils/ResourceTypes.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/libs/utils/ResourceTypes.cpp b/libs/utils/ResourceTypes.cpp index 03d2e21..f287298 100644 --- a/libs/utils/ResourceTypes.cpp +++ b/libs/utils/ResourceTypes.cpp @@ -1949,7 +1949,7 @@ ssize_t ResTable::getResource(uint32_t resID, Res_value* outValue, bool mayBeBag desiredConfig = overrideConfig; } - ssize_t rc = BAD_INDEX; + ssize_t rc = BAD_VALUE; size_t ip = grp->packages.size(); while (ip > 0) { ip--; |
